This is great. The entire month of July Craft Beer Month in Michigan — as if you needed a special reason to celebrate the hoppy elixir of the locavore movement.
Michigan, with more than 200 small brewers and brewpubs, is now the fifth-largest beer producer in the country, according to the Michigan Beer and Wine Wholesalers Association. Even more breweries are on tap.
Spencer Nevins, the Michigan Beer and Wine Wholesalers Association president, says the state’s beer distributors play a pivotal role in helping local craft brewers grow their brand and provide incomparable access to retailers, big and small, across the state.

Michigan beer distributors will continue to play that crucial role in this month-long celebration of Michigan craft beer as brewers showcase their brands at tap takeovers, special events and festivals, the group said.
